Step-by-step explanation:
To find the distance between the two cars, we can treat their paths as the legs of a right triangle. The northbound car has traveled 3 kilometers and the eastbound car has traveled 1 kilometer. Using the Pythagorean theorem, we can calculate the distance between the cars as follows:
d = sqrt((3 km)^2 + (1 km)^2) = sqrt(9 + 1) = sqrt(10) ≈ 3.16 km
Therefore, the two cars are approximately 3.16 kilometers apart when measured in a straight line.
